Can anyone beat my muffler hanger deterioration record?

Installed a pair of new muffler hangers 7,500 miles ago (less than a year ago). Both now have cracks throughout and need to be replaced.

Is that a record? Do I get a prize?

No you don't get a prize.

In fact, you get just the opposite for buying the cheap Chinese donuts for $1.00. They make a better version for about $4.00:


Search part number 1074920044 .

I've found used OE ones at Pick-N-Pull that were still in good shape. The Canadian ones I put on my first 240D rotted apart in three years. I replaced those with ones from my local Mercedes dealer for $2 each. Don't know where they were made though. Hopefully NOT China.
